Kpa-clawbot 088b4381c3 Fix: Hash Stats 'By Repeaters' includes non-repeater nodes (#654)
## Summary

The "By Repeaters" section on the Hash Stats analytics page was counting
**all** node types (companions, room servers, sensors, etc.) instead of
only repeaters. This made the "By Repeaters" distribution identical to
"Multi-Byte Hash Adopters", defeating the purpose of the breakdown.

Fixes #652

## Root Cause

`computeAnalyticsHashSizes()` in `cmd/server/store.go` built its
`byNode` map from advert packet data without cross-referencing node
roles from the node store. Both `distributionByRepeaters` and
`multiByteNodes` consumed this unfiltered map.

## Changes

### `cmd/server/store.go`
- Build a `nodeRoleByPK` lookup map from `getCachedNodesAndPM()` at the
start of the function
- Store `role` in each `byNode` entry when processing advert packets
- **`distributionByRepeaters`**: filter to only count nodes whose role
contains "repeater"
- **`multiByteNodes`**: include `role` field in output so the frontend
can filter/group by node type

### `cmd/server/coverage_test.go`
- Add `TestHashSizesDistributionByRepeatersFiltersRole`: verifies that
companion nodes are excluded from `distributionByRepeaters` but included
in `multiByteNodes` with correct role

### `cmd/server/routes_test.go`
- Fix `TestHashAnalyticsZeroHopAdvert`: invalidate node cache after DB
insert so role lookup works
- Fix `TestAnalyticsHashSizeSameNameDifferentPubkey`: insert node
records as repeaters + invalidate cache

## Testing

All `cmd/server` tests pass (68 insertions, 3 deletions across 3 files).
